Why graphene is used in solar cell?

Graphene’s high electronic conductivity, transparency and flexibility make them useful in heterojunction solar cells, where they can be employed in many different ways including electrodes (both anodes and cathodes), acceptor layers, donor layers, buffer layers and active layers.

Why graphene is not used in solar panels?

Solar cells require materials that are conductive and allow light to get through, thus benefiting from graphene’s superb conductivity and transparency. Graphene is indeed a great conductor, but it is not very good at collecting the electrical current produced inside the solar cell.

Which material is best used in solar cells?

Silicon
Silicon is, by far, the most common semiconductor material used in solar cells, representing approximately 95\% of the modules sold today. It is also the second most abundant material on Earth (after oxygen) and the most common semiconductor used in computer chips.

Is there graphite in solar panels?

Graphite is essential to silicon production used in solar panels. It is also used in the batteries that store the energy from solar and wind farms once the energy is produced. Tesla has built a business around lithium ion batteries but also consequently, graphite.

What materials make up a solar cell?

Solar cells are made from silicon boules. These are polycrystalline structures that have the atomic structure of a single crystal. The most commonly used method for the creation of the boule is known as the Czochralski method. During this process, a seed crystal of silicon is dipped into melted polycrystalline silicon.
